Cookies and Tracking

We use cookies to keep your session active and remember your account preferences. You can manage cookie settings through your browser. Disabling cookies may affect how certain account features work.

Account Security

Your account is protected by OTP-based login verification. If you notice any unrecognised access, contact support immediately to lock your account and review recent activity.

Data Retention

We keep your account data for as long as your account is open and for the legally required period after closure. You may request early deletion where permitted by applicable law.

Third-Party Access

Payment processors and fraud-screening services receive only the data they need to complete your transaction. No marketing third parties receive your personal information from us.
